首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Gridview ItemTemplate中多个Eval字段的最佳技术?

在Gridview ItemTemplate中,如果需要显示多个Eval字段,可以使用以下技术:

  1. 使用嵌套的Repeater控件:在ItemTemplate中,可以使用嵌套的Repeater控件来显示多个Eval字段。在Repeater控件的ItemTemplate中,可以使用Eval语句来绑定数据。
  2. 使用多个Eval语句:在ItemTemplate中,可以使用多个Eval语句来显示多个Eval字段。例如:
代码语言:txt
复制
<%# Eval("Field1") %>
<%# Eval("Field2") %>
<%# Eval("Field3") %>
  1. 使用自定义控件:可以创建一个自定义控件,该控件可以接受多个Eval字段作为参数,并在控件内部显示这些字段。
  2. 使用数据绑定表达式:可以使用数据绑定表达式来显示多个Eval字段。例如:
代码语言:txt
复制
<%# DataBinder.Eval(Container.DataItem, "Field1") %>
<%# DataBinder.Eval(Container.DataItem, "Field2") %>
<%# DataBinder.Eval(Container.DataItem, "Field3") %>

总之,在Gridview ItemTemplate中,可以使用多种技术来显示多个Eval字段,具体选择哪种技术取决于具体情况和需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

GridView编辑删除操作

大家好,又见面了,我是全栈君 第一种:使用DataSource数据源中自带的编辑删除方法,这样的不经常使用,在这里就不加说明了。...绑定好后,对GridView加入绑定列 和编辑列 (注意这里,加入好后不做不论什么修改,千万不要将它们转换为模板列),加入好后,将所要绑定的数据库表字段填入 属性中。...GridView1.EditIndex = -1; GView(); } 说明:此方法中,如果要求某个绑定列不做编辑,则在它的前台代码中增加ReadOnly=”true”就可以。...;//注意:日期字段不要加ToString(),否则会报错,而nvarchar和int的字段能够加 string hhh = ((TextBox)(GridView1.Rows[e.RowIndex... GridView> 以上绑定中,不管是Eval或者Bind都能够。

1.7K20
  • GridView用法,分页

    ,”主键字段名称2″……}; GvId.DataBind(); PS:这里的主键字段名称1是实体类中的属性名,对应数据库中主键字段 取:gvId.DataKeys[index].Value.ToString...中如何将取出来的0,1转换为中文,比如性别用“男女“表示 通过模板列来实现: itemTemplate>中通过表达式来实现 ’ > itemTemplate> 4.在模板列中可以调用服务器端的方法: 假设在当前页面的后置代码中有这么个方法: public string GetDeptName...在页面模板列中调用: itemTemplate>中通过表达式来实现 <asp:Label runat=”server ” ID=”gender” Text='eval_r...(“id”).ToString())%>’ > itemTemplate> 这里需要注意下传的参数eval_r(“id”).ToString(),好像这里无论怎么转型,传到后置代码中

    1.2K30

    ASP.NET2.0中用Gridview控件操作数据

    在本文中,将探讨Gridview控件中的一些功能特性和用法,如果各位读者对Gridview控件不大了解,可以通过《 使用ASP.NET 2.0中的Gridview控件》一文,来对Gridview控件有个初步的认识...1、使用Gridview插入新记录 在Gridview控件中,可以实现插入新记录的操作(见《使用ASP.NET 2.0中的Gridview控件》)一文,但如果想实现在Gridview中,实现在Gridview...而在更新代码button1_click事件中,将首先使用Gridview1.footerrow.findcontrol的方法,将用户新增的各字段的值提取出来,然后分别赋值给sqldatasource的insertparameters...,并且要设置好insertparameters集合中,各字段的类型和名称即可。...2、一次性更新所有的Gridview记录 我们经常会遇到这样的情况,在Gridview中列出的所有记录中,有时要同时修改多条记录,并且将其保存到数据库中去。那么在Gridview中应该如何实现呢?

    1.5K10

    GridView实战一:自定义分页、排序、修改、插入、删除

    > 说明: 1.显示状态时:对于只显示文字串的用Eval("字段名")%>直接绑定,而对于单选组(性别)的内容就放在GridView的OnRowDataBound来绑定。...2.编辑状态时:复选组、单选组合下拉列表都在OnRowDataBound来绑定;这里没有用数据源控件,所以用字段名")%>和Eval("字段名")%>没区别,字段名...3.新增状态:因为GridView自身附带新增记录的功能,所以选择在EmptyDataTemplate中实现新增的功能(借鉴其他同行的做法!)...4.分页功能:本例是将分页功能放置到gridview的PagerTemplate中实现。...因为DropDownList包含在GridView中是动态生成的,当PostBack时GridView并不会恢复其中的动态内容;如果把分页功能放在GridView以外实现,那么动态生成的时DropDownList

    2.8K100

    C# Eval在aspx页面中的用法及作用

    下面的例子演示了如何使用新的简化的Eval数据绑定语法绑定到DataList数据项模板(ItemTemplate)中的Image、Label和HyperLink控件。...如果此时的数据绑定表达式是Eval("数据库中某个表的某个字段")等,那么必须把TextBox1放在某个循环显示的控件的模板中才正确,否则会提 示:Eval()、XPath() 和 Bind() 这类数据绑定方法只能在数据绑定控件的上下文中使用...其实就是想让你把TextBox1放在像Repeater,DataList,GridView这样 的控件的模板中。 二,数据绑定绑定表达式包含在在页面中的任何位置。...如果此时的数据绑定表达式是Eval("数据库中某个表的某个字段")等,那么必须把 Eval("数据绑定表达式1")%> Eval("数据绑定表达式2")%> 放在像Repeater,DataList...,GridView这样的控件的模板中。

    7.2K20

    Gridview导出到Excel,Gridview中的各类控件,Gridview中删除记录的处理

    Asp.net 2.0中新增的gridview控件,是十分强大的数据展示控件,在前面的系列文章里,分别展示了其中很多的基本用法和技巧(详见< ASP.NET 2.0中Gridview控件高级技巧>)...一、Gridview中的内容导出到Excel 在日常工作中,经常要将gridview中的内容导出到excel报表中去,在asp.net 2.0中,同样可以很方便地实现将整个gridview中的内容导出到...二、访问gridview中的各类控件 在gridview中,经常要访问其中的各类控件,比如dropdownlist,radiobutton,checkbox等,下面归纳下在gridview中访问各类控件的方法...然后在页面的itemtemplate中,如下设计: <ItemTemplate> <asp:DropDownList ID="DropDownList1" runat="server" DataSource..." + DataBinder.Eval(e.Row.DataItem, "id") + "')"); } } 在这段代码中,首先检查是否是datarow,是的话则得到每个linkbutton,再为其添加客户端代码

    2.6K20

    ASP.NET WEB项目中GridView与Repeater数据绑定控件的用法

    ASP.NET WEB项目中GridView与Repeater数据绑定控件的用法 目录 ASP.NET WEB项目中GridView与Repeater数据绑定控件的用法 前言 环境 测试数据(单表)...DBHelper GridView用法 Repeater用法 总结 前言 ASP.NET WEB是一门非常简单的课程内容,我们大概用三章的内容来包含所有的知识点,三章分为 1、ASP.NET WEB项目创建与文件上传操作...2、ASP.NET WEB项目中Cookie与Session的用法 3、ASP.NET WEB项目中GridView与Repeater数据绑定控件的用法 分为三章,基本上将具体的用法讲解完毕,...Eval("introduce") %> ItemTemplate> 的文章,包含整个的增删改查,希望能帮助到大家,链接再下方: ASP.NET Web——GridView完整增删改查示例(全篇幅包含sql脚本)大二结业考试必备技能

    1.2K20
    领券